Weingut Egon Müller Scharzhofberg Spätlese is the undisputed global benchmark for Riesling. Farmed by the Müller family since 1797, the estate's legend is rooted in the Scharzhofberg—a steep, south-facing wall of grey-blue slate. The 2024 vintage marks a return to the classic Saar profile: a masterclass in transparency, where razor-sharp acidity provides the structural counterpoint to the vineyard's natural late-harvest sweetness.

The Scharzhofberg Distinction

Drawn exclusively from the Grosse Lage Scharzhofberg, this Spätlese is defined by selective hand-picking and a traditional vinification that prioritizes aromatic clarity over raw power.

  • 2024 Vintage Clarity: Produced during a cooler growing season, the 2024 showcases an extraordinary acid line and crystalline mineral focus absent in warmer years.
  • Fuder Vinification: Fermented with ambient yeasts in traditional 1,000-liter old oak casks, allowing the wine to breathe without introducing overt wood character.
  • Structural Tension: The hallmark Müller style—residual sugar balanced so perfectly by slate-driven acidity that the wine drinks with off-dry precision.
Sensory Profile

Nose: Wet slate, white peach, and lime zest. Sophisticated layers of apricot, white flowers, and honeysuckle develop alongside a faint, clean smoky character.

Palate: Light-to-medium bodied with immense textural presence. Crystalline citrus and peach lead into a mid-palate dominated by mineral chalk and razor-sharp acidity.

Finish: Exceptionally long and resonant. A persistent closing of saline minerals and slate that sustains the mid-palate weight without the need for heaviness.

The Riesling Apex

Egon Müller sits in the elite Riesling tier alongside J.J. Prüm. While Prüm favors a richer, reductive style, Müller is the purist's choice for "chiseled" transparency and fine-grained mineral delineation.

Technical Specifications
Producer Weingut Egon Müller, Wiltingen
Region Saar, Mosel, Germany
Vineyard Scharzhofberg (Grosse Lage)
Prädikat Spätlese (Late Harvest)
Vintage 2024 (Classic / Cool Style)
Vinification Ambient Yeast / Old Oak Fuder
Alcohol ~7.5–9% ABV

Recommended Serving

To allow the wet slate and honeysuckle aromatics to fully bloom, serve at 45–50°F. We recommend a standard white wine glass over a narrow Riesling flute to better capture the mid-palate complexity. This wine is a peerless partner for Asian preparations with chili and ginger, sushi, or pork belly, though its structural acidity also allows it to pair beautifully with blue cheese or fresh fruit-based desserts.
